Output 73c4e651d13ca888d60ca4eddbc698ee27c37eed64aff6b8237fd2568a0439d2:0

value
353643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2f7fc0202b0ec2cc27eef12c8e34e4f431a784f OP_EQUAL
address
3NP7iA13Vi8bh3hMf56DfQS6S4B7357BrM
transaction
73c4e651d13ca888d60ca4eddbc698ee27c37eed64aff6b8237fd2568a0439d2
spent
true